Output 0dd6064b529ebfdf4cee7d186deadd91a4d17a7642ecdf6254dee028ef88bd36:0

value
25005
script pubkey
OP_0 OP_PUSHBYTES_32 ecf69373df9b2bc0ead9a83f2514ebbb43694ca4c5fe1bd1af035d9435dae1a3
address
bc1qanmfxu7lnv4up6ke4qlj298thdpkjn9ychlph5d0qdwegdw6ux3sr0u9nq
transaction
0dd6064b529ebfdf4cee7d186deadd91a4d17a7642ecdf6254dee028ef88bd36
confirmations
2860
spent
true